CBI gets custody of Shahjahan Sheikh after fresh Calcutta High Court directive

New Delhi, March 6

The West Bengal Police on Wednesday handed over the custody of suspended Trinamool Congress leader Shahjahan Sheikh to the CBI following a fresh directive from the Calcutta High Court.

The development took place after the HC once again ordered the West Bengal administration to hand over the custody of Sheikh to the agency by 4.15 pm. A CBI team had arrived by that time to take his custody.

Sheikh was finally handed over to the CBI custody around 6.45 pm, sources said.

Besides, the CBI will also take over the case of the attack on ED officials that took place at Sandeshkhali on January 5. The ED officials had gone to Sheikh’s house for a raid in connection with the ration “scam”.
